Defamation of Character
The act of communicating false statements about a person that injure that person's reputation.
Implied Contract
A contract that is created by the acceptance or conduct of the parties rather than the written word.
Rogers' Protection Motivation Theory
A theory suggesting that people protect themselves based on four factors: perceived severity, perceived vulnerability, response efficacy, and self-efficacy.
